I solved it.
- Put tape over pin 23+25 and 31+33 to block usb3 pins.
- Replaced kerneldriver qcserial with the option driver
- Connected to the modem and sent the at-command to disable usb3 (AT+QUSBCFG=“SS”,0)
- Removed tape from card.
